Human Resources Assistant, Except Payroll and Timekeeping Salary in Western Montana nonmetropolitan area, Montana

The annual salary statistics of human resources assistants, except payroll and timekeeping in Western Montana nonmetropolitan area, Montana is shown in Table 1. The wage statistics of human resources assistants, except payroll and timekeeping in Western Montana nonmetropolitan area is based on the national compensation survey conducted by the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ics in 2022 and published in April 2023 [1].

Table 1. Annual Salary of Human Resources Assistants, Except Payroll and Timekeeping in Western Montana nonmetropolitan area, Montana

Percentile BracketAverage Annual Salary
10th Percentile Wage
$25,380
25th Percentile Wage
$27,640
50th Percentile Wage
$33,650
75th Percentile Wage
$43,210
90th Percentile Wage
$47,910

Table 1 shows the average annual salary for human resources assistants, except payroll and timekeeping in Western Montana nonmetropolitan area, Montana in 5 percentile scales. The average annual salary for the 90th percentile (the top 10 percent of the highest paid) is $47,910. The median (50th percentile) annual salary is $33,650. The average annual salary for the bottom 10 percent earners is $25,380.

Table 2. Compare Human Resources Assistant, Except Payroll and Timekeeping Salary in Western Montana nonmetropolitan area with Other Montana Cities

From Table 3 we note that with a median annual salary of $33,650, Western Montana nonmetropolitan area is the lowest paying city for human resources assistants, except payroll and timekeeping in state of Montana, following city of Southwestern Montana nonmetropolitan area (median annual salary of $46,110). Also we note that in comparison, the annual salary of human resources assistants, except payroll and timekeeping in Western Montana nonmetropolitan area is about 27.0 percent (27.0%) lower than that of the highest paying city Southwestern Montana nonmetropolitan area.

Cities/Areas Median Annual Salary
Southwestern Montana nonmetropolitan area
$46,110
Missoula
$45,000
Billings
$40,250
Central Montana nonmetropolitan area
$35,470
Great Falls
$34,540
Western Montana nonmetropolitan area
$33,650
